Claims
- 1. A method of data transmission, said method comprising:
encoding an ordered set of m data values to produce a corresponding series of ordered n-tuples; and according to the series of ordered n-tuples, transmitting a plurality of bursts, each burst occupying at least one of a plurality n of frequency bands, wherein, for each of the plurality of bursts, a frequency band occupied by the burst is indicated by the order within its n-tuple of an element corresponding to the burst, and wherein a bandwidth of at least one of the plurality of bursts is at least two percent of the center frequency of the burst, and wherein information is encoded into a polarity of at least one of the plurality of bursts.
- 2. The method of data transmission according to claim 1, wherein, for each among at least some of the plurality of bursts, the burst corresponds to at least one element to the exclusion of other elements, and a value of at least one such corresponding element indicates a polarity of the burst.
- 3. The method of data transmission according to claim 2, wherein, for each of the plurality of bursts, a time of transmission of the burst relative to the rest of the plurality of bursts is indicated by the order, within the series of ordered n-tuples, of the n-tuple that includes the element corresponding to the burst.
- 4. The method of data transmission according to claim 1, wherein at least one of the plurality of bursts corresponds to a plurality of the m data values.
- 5. The method of data transmission according to claim 1, wherein a duration of at least one of the plurality of bursts is less than ten cycles.
- 6. The method of data transmission according to claim 1, wherein each among the series of ordered n-tuples corresponds to one among a series of time periods, and
wherein each of the series of time periods has a different start time, and wherein, for each of the plurality of bursts, the time period during which the burst is launched is indicated by the location within the series of n-tuples of an n-tuple that includes an element corresponding to the burst, and wherein during each time period, no more than one of the plurality of bursts is launched.
- 7. The method of data transmission according to claim 1, wherein said plurality of bursts includes a first burst occupying one of the plurality of frequency bands and a second burst occupying a different one of the plurality of frequency bands, and
wherein at least one frequency point exists at which the amplitude of the first burst is within twenty decibels of the maximum amplitude of the first burst and at which the amplitude of the second burst is within twenty decibels of the maximum amplitude of the second burst.
- 8. A transmitter comprising:
an encoder configured to receive an ordered set of m data values and to produce a corresponding series of ordered n-tuples; and a signal generator configured to transmit, according to the series of ordered n-tuples, a plurality of bursts, each burst occupying at least one of a plurality n of frequency bands, wherein, for each of the plurality of bursts, a frequency band occupied by the burst is indicated by the order within its n-tuple of an element corresponding to the burst, and wherein a bandwidth of at least one of the plurality of bursts is at least two percent of the center frequency of the burst, and wherein said transmitter is configured to encode information into a polarity of at least one of the plurality of bursts.
- 9. The transmitter according to claim 8, wherein said signal generator includes a plurality of burst generators,
wherein each of the plurality of burst generators is configured to receive a trigger event and to generate at least one of the plurality of bursts according to the trigger event, and wherein at least one of the burst generators is configured to encode information into a polarity of a burst.
- 10. The transmitter according to claim 8, said transmitter further comprising a signal launcher configured to receive the plurality of bursts and to transmit the plurality of bursts over a transmission medium.
- 11. The transmitter according to claim 8, wherein said signal generator includes an oscillator configured to output a signal over a selectable one of at least two of the plurality n of frequency bands, and
wherein said signal generator is configured to encode information into a polarity of a burst.
- 12. The transmitter according to claim 8, wherein, for each of the plurality of bursts, a time of transmission of the burst relative to the rest of the plurality of bursts is indicated by the order, within the series of ordered n-tuples, of an n-tuple that includes an element corresponding to the burst.
- 13. A method of data reception, said method comprising:
receiving a plurality of bursts, each burst occupying at least one of a plurality n of frequency bands, wherein information is encoded into a polarity of at least one of the plurality of bursts, obtaining a series of ordered n-tuples based on the plurality of bursts; and decoding the series of ordered n-tuples to produce an ordered set of m data values, wherein, for each of the plurality of bursts, the order within its n-tuple of an element corresponding to the burst is indicated by a frequency band occupied by the burst, and wherein a bandwidth of at least one of the plurality of bursts is at least two percent of the center frequency of the burst, and wherein information is decoded from a polarity encoded into at least one of the plurality of bursts.
- 14. The method of data reception according to claim 13, wherein, for each of the plurality of bursts, the order, within the series of ordered n-tuples, of an n-tuple that includes an element corresponding to the burst is indicated by a timing of the burst relative to the rest of the plurality of bursts.
- 15. The method of data reception according to claim 13, wherein at least one of the plurality of bursts corresponds to a plurality of the m data values.
- 16. A receiver comprising:
a signal detector configured to receive a signal including a plurality of bursts, wherein information is encoded into a polarity of at least one of the plurality of bursts, each burst occupying at least one of a plurality n of frequency bands, and to output a series of ordered n-tuples based on the plurality of bursts; and a decoder configured to produce an ordered set of m data values from the series of ordered n-tuples, wherein the signal detector is configured to output, for each of the plurality of bursts, an element corresponding to the burst such that an order of the element within its n-tuple corresponds to a frequency band occupied by the burst, and wherein a bandwidth of at least one of the plurality of bursts is at least two percent of the center frequency of the burst, and wherein the signal detector is configured to output information based on the polarity of at least one of the plurality of bursts.
- 17. The receiver according to claim 16, wherein the signal detector includes at least one correlator configured to detect a received burst based on a correlation of a template with at least a portion of the received signal, and
wherein the at least one correlator is configured to detect a polarity of a received burst.
- 18. The receiver according to claim 16, wherein the signal detector includes at least one filter configured to select at least a portion of a corresponding one of the plurality n of frequency bands.
- 19. The receiver according to claim 16, wherein at least one of the plurality of bursts corresponds to a plurality of the m data values.
RELATED APPLICATIONS
[0001] This application claims priority to U.S. Provisional Patent Applications No. 60/359,044 (“POLARITY SIGNALING METHODS BASED ON TDMF UWB WAVEFORMS,” filed Feb. 20, 2002); No. 60/359,045 (“CHANNELIZATION METHODS FOR TIME-DIVISION MULTIPLE FREQUENCY COMMUNICATION CHANNELS,” filed Feb. 20, 2002); No. 60/359,064 (“HYBRID SIGNALING METHODS BASED ON TDMF UWB WAVEFORMS,” filed Feb. 20, 2002); and No. 60/359,147 (“TRANSMITTER AND RECEIVER FOR A TIME-DIVISION MULTIPLE FREQUENCY COMMUNICATION SYSTEM,” filed Feb. 20, 2002); No. 60/359,094 (“PHY LEVEL ERROR DETECTION/CORRECTION FOR TDMF,” filed Feb. 20, 2002); No. 60/359,095 (“ADAPTING TDMF SIGNALING TO NARROWBAND INTERFERENCE SOURCES,” filed Feb. 20, 2002); and No. 60/359,046 (“METHOD OF DECODING TO EXPLOIT TDMF (FREQUENCY/TIME) CHARACTERISTICS,” filed Feb. 20, 2002); all of which applications are incorporated in their entirety herein by reference.
[0002] This application is a continuation-in-part (CIP) of the following U.S. patent applications, all of which are incorporated in their entirety herein by reference: U.S. patent application Ser. No. 10/255,111 (“METHOD AND APPARATUS FOR DATA TRANSFER USING A TIME DIVISION MULTIPLE FREQUENCY SCHEME”, filed Sep. 26, 2002); and U.S. patent application Ser. No. 10/255,103 (“TUNABLE OSCILLATOR”, filed Sep. 26, 2002).
[0003] This application is related to the following U.S. patent application filed concurrently herewith, all of which are incorporated in its entirety herein by reference: U.S. patent application Ser. No. ______ (“METHOD AND APPARATUS FOR DATA TRANSFER USING A TIME DIVISION MULTIPLE FREQUENCY SCHEME WITH ADDITIONAL MODULATION”, Attorney Docket No. 81506); U.S. patent application No. ______ (“FLEXIBLE METHOD AND APPARATUS FOR ENCODING AND DECODING SIGNALS USING A TIME DIVISION MULTIPLE FREQUENCY SCHEME”, Attorney Docket No. 81531); U.S. patent application Ser. No. ______ (“METHOD AND APPARATUS FOR ADAPTING MULTI-BAND ULTRA-WIDEBAND SIGNALING TO INTERFERENCE SOURCES”, Attorney Docket No. 81532); and U.S. patent application Ser. No. ______ (“METHOD AND APPARATUS FOR ADAPTING SIGNALING TO MAXIMIZE THE EFFICIENCY OF SPECTRUM USAGE FOR MULTI-BAND SYSTEMS IN THE PRESENCE OF INTERFERENCE”, Attorney Docket No. 81536).
Provisional Applications (9)
|
Number |
Date |
Country |
|
60359044 |
Feb 2002 |
US |
|
60359045 |
Feb 2002 |
US |
|
60359064 |
Feb 2002 |
US |
|
60359147 |
Feb 2002 |
US |
|
60359094 |
Feb 2002 |
US |
|
60359095 |
Feb 2002 |
US |
|
60359046 |
Feb 2002 |
US |
|
60326093 |
Sep 2001 |
US |
|
60326093 |
Sep 2001 |
US |
Continuation in Parts (2)
|
Number |
Date |
Country |
Parent |
10255103 |
Sep 2002 |
US |
Child |
10372075 |
Feb 2003 |
US |
Parent |
10255111 |
Sep 2002 |
US |
Child |
10372075 |
Feb 2003 |
US |